We are looking for an experienced Plumber. As a member of the Facilities team, you will proactively support the Facilities leadership team in all operational aspects of resort plumbing. This role supports the entire resort and at times will require you to work with internal and external service providers. The work will also involve planned and unplanned work across the estate.
As a Plumber, you will be carrying out planned and unplanned works to current legislative standards and will plan and evaluate repairs, replacement parts, inventory and innovation. Relevant tools and equipment are all provided. Typical working hours cover five days over a seven shift pattern that includes weekends and evenings at times, totalling 40 hours weekly.
About You
You should be able to demonstrate experience in working in a maintenance environment within a plumbing specialism. A current recognised qualification as a skilled Plumber/Engineer with formal electrical qualifications would be an advantage (Domestic Installer, C+G or equivalent, hot water storage system, unvented G3, driving license) will also be required. You will have the ability to prioritise work and work to deadlines and have working knowledge and experience of relevant regulations and H&S procedures. You should have good communication skills and take pride in detailed record keeping. You should hold a professional and positive approach at all times in the working environment and enjoy working both as part of a team and individually.
